Local Non-Profit Collecting Hygiene Kits for Oklahoma Tornado Victims
In the past decade, the Bedford family foundation, Color My World has donated over $63,000 in soft goods to families affected by Hurricane Sandy, Indonesian Tsunami, Hurricane Katrina and Kate, Earthquakes in Haiti, China and Chile and aid for Africa and Nicaragua. Color My World has also distributed locally to projects and families in need locally in New Hampshire, supporting Angie's Shelter …
